Bastion, the action RPG from Supergiant Games, transports players to a beautifully crafted and post-apocalyptic world. As a seasoned retro gaming enthusiast, I must say that the game manages to capture the essence of classic gaming, while also introducing modern gameplay elements.
One of the standout features of Bastion is its stunning hand-painted visuals. The vibrant colors and detailed environments evoke a sense of nostalgia, reminiscent of the artistic styles seen in beloved retro games. Every frame feels like a work of art, with the attention to detail truly enhancing the overall experience.
The gameplay in Bastion follows the tried and true formula of an action RPG. Players control the protagonist, known as the Kid, as he battles through hordes of enemies using an impressive array of weapons. The combat feels fluid and satisfying, with each weapon offering its own unique playstyle. It’s a treat for fans of old-school combat mechanics.
One aspect that sets Bastion apart is its dynamic narration. As the Kid moves through the world, a velvety-smooth voice provides a running commentary on his actions. This narrative technique adds depth to the story and character development, offering a unique and immersive experience.
However, while Bastion is undoubtedly a visually stunning and well-executed game, it does have a few shortcomings. The story, while engaging, can feel a bit disjointed at times, leaving players craving for more depth and cohesion. Additionally, the difficulty curve can be quite steep, which may frustrate less experienced players.
Overall, Bastion for PlayStation 4 is a fantastic addition to any retro gaming enthusiast’s library. Its stunning visuals, engaging gameplay, and dynamic narration make it a true gem in today’s vast sea of offerings. While it may have a few minor flaws, the nostalgia-inducing design elements and the captivating world make it a must-play for any fan of classic gaming.
